Yandex has introduced its first device in the security category — a smart IP camera. It can broadcast video in real time, save recordings to a memory card or the cloud, and send notifications to the user’s smartphone if it detects movement or a person in the frame.

The device will help monitor the house during vacation or while the user is at work. The IP camera can be integrated into the smart home ecosystem – the “Home with Alice” application and Wi-Fi are enough to connect. The device can be controlled both through the application and by voice commands to Alice. The image from the camera can be displayed on the phone screen, TV Station or Duo Max Station display. The IP camera can be used in existing smart home scenarios or new ones can be created for it. For example, when the phrase “Alice, I’m leaving” is said, the lights in the apartment will go out and the camera will start recording so that the user can make sure that everything is in order at home at any time.

The camera supports recording in resolution up to 2K, has a viewing angle of 103 degrees and is equipped with a 350-degree rotation mechanism. The shooting direction can be changed directly from the application. Recordings from the camera can be saved to a memory card or to the cloud with a subscription. The camera can shoot continuously or only when movement or a person is detected in the frame.

The IP camera can be turned off via the app or using voice commands: “Alice, turn on privacy mode” or “Alice, turn off the camera.” You can also set a scenario for turning off – for example, so that the camera automatically turns off and turns away at 19:00 or after the phrase “Alice, I’m home.” The device is equipped with a mute button, like on Yandex Stations. When you press it, the camera will turn the lens away and completely turn off the microphone. You can turn it on only by pressing the button again.

The smart IP camera from Yandex will go on sale in June. The cost of the device is not reported.
